核心概念界定
在信息技术与系统管理领域,“设置权限名称”这一表述,通常指向一个具体的、用于标识和区分不同访问控制规则的文本标签。它并非一个孤立存在的技术术语,而是权限管理体系中的一个关键构成要素。简单来说,当我们在各类软件、操作系统、网络平台或企业内部系统中,为不同的用户或角色分配特定的操作权利时,需要为这些权利组合赋予一个清晰、唯一的名称,这个名称就是“权限名称”。它的核心功能在于,让系统管理员和普通用户都能通过这个直观的文本标识,快速理解该权限所涵盖的具体操作范围与能力边界,从而实现高效、准确的权限分配与管理。
主要应用场景分类根据应用环境的不同,设置权限名称的实践主要可归纳为以下几类。首先是操作系统层面,例如在常见的桌面或服务器操作系统中,为文件或文件夹设置“只读”、“修改”或“完全控制”等权限名称,用以管理用户对存储资源的访问。其次是数据库管理系统,在这里,权限名称可能体现为“选择”、“插入”、“更新”、“删除”等,精确控制用户对数据表的操作能力。再者是复杂的业务应用系统与网络平台,权限名称的设计更为多样和精细化,可能包括“内容发布”、“订单审核”、“财务报销审批”、“系统配置查看”等,直接对应具体的业务流程环节。最后,在云计算与多租户服务环境中,权限名称还承担着隔离不同租户或项目资源访问的重要角色。
命名原则与价值体现一个设计良好的权限名称,绝非随意为之,它遵循着清晰性、唯一性、可读性与可维护性等基本原则。名称本身应当能够望文生义,避免使用晦涩难懂的技术缩写或内部代号,确保任何具有相关背景知识的管理者都能准确理解其含义。同时,在整个权限集合中,每个名称必须是唯一的,以防止权限分配时出现混淆或冲突。从价值角度看,科学设置权限名称是构建稳健安全体系的基石。它通过将抽象的操作许可转化为具体的管理对象,极大地简化了权限配置的复杂度,提升了管理效率,并为系统的安全审计和合规检查提供了清晰的追溯依据。因此,理解“设置权限名称是什么”,实质上是把握了现代数字系统实现精细化、人性化访问控制的第一步。
定义内涵的深度剖析
“设置权限名称”这一行为,本质上是一个将访问控制策略进行语义化封装和标签化的过程。在计算机科学的访问控制模型中,无论是自主访问控制、强制访问控制还是基于角色的访问控制,最终都需要一种方式来表达“谁”在“什么条件”下可以对“哪个资源”进行“何种操作”。权限名称,正是对这一系列复杂逻辑的一个高度概括和用户友好的表达。它像是一个精心设计的索引关键词,背后链接着具体的操作代码、资源标识符以及可能的条件判断逻辑。当我们为一个权限集合命名时,实际上是在为系统安全策略库中添加一个可被管理和引用的逻辑单元。这个名称成为了连接管理意图(希望控制什么)与系统实现(如何控制)的桥梁,使得非技术人员也能参与到权限管理的讨论与决策中,降低了安全管理的技术门槛。
技术实现层面的分类阐述从技术实现与架构视角审视,权限名称的设置与应用可以根据其粒度和耦合度进行细分。第一类是原子操作级权限名称。这类名称直接对应系统最基础、不可再分的操作,例如“文件读取”、“记录创建”、“接口调用”。它们是构建更复杂权限的基石,名称通常直接来源于系统API或底层操作指令。第二类是功能模块级权限名称。这类名称聚合了完成某一特定业务功能所需的一系列原子操作,例如“员工信息管理”这个权限名称,可能内在地包含了对员工信息表的查询、新增、修改等原子权限。它的设置更贴近用户的业务视角。第三类是数据域或资源级权限名称。尤其在多租户或复杂数据隔离场景下,权限名称可能与特定的数据范围绑定,例如“部门A数据访问”、“项目X文档编辑”,名称本身就隐含了资源筛选的条件。第四类是复合条件型权限名称。这类名称可能动态关联了时间、地点、设备状态等多种条件,例如“非工作时间登录审批”、“外部网络访问受限模式”,其名称设计需要反映出条件约束的核心特征。
跨领域实践的场景化解析在不同的行业与应用领域,设置权限名称的具体实践呈现出鲜明的场景化特征。在企业资源计划系统中,权限名称紧密围绕财务、供应链、人力资源等核心流程设计,如“凭证过账”、“采购订单核准”、“薪资数据查看”,名称直接体现了职责分离的控制思想。在内容管理系统中,权限名称则反映内容生命周期,如“草稿编辑”、“排版审核”、“首页推荐设置”,名称清晰划分了内容生产流水线上的不同岗位权责。在开发运维一体化平台中,权限名称与软件交付链路结合,例如“代码库推送”、“生产环境部署”、“监控告警静默”,名称确保了开发、测试、运维各环节的安全隔离。而在物联网平台,权限名称需管控对物理设备的访问,如“设备重启指令下发”、“传感器数据读取”、“固件远程升级”,名称直接关联了物理世界的控制动作。这些差异化的实践表明,优秀的权限名称设计必须深度融入业务语境,成为业务流程在权限层面的自然映射。
设计方法论与最佳实践要系统化地设置出有效的权限名称,需要遵循一套严谨的设计方法论。首要步骤是业务能力解构,即通过分析用户故事、业务流程和系统功能,识别出所有需要被控制的独立操作点与数据实体。其次是进行权限抽象与归类,将识别出的操作点按照逻辑相关性聚合,形成权限模块,并为每个模块构思一个能准确概括其功能范围且无歧义的名称。命名时应采用“动词+宾语”或“宾语+操作”的常见结构,例如“删除日志”、“客户合同审批”,确保动作主体明确。同时,需建立统一的命名词汇表,规范核心动词和宾语的用法,避免同义不同名或同名不同义的情况。在大型系统中,引入层级命名空间也是常见做法,例如用“系统管理:用户:重置密码”这样的点分结构来体现权限的层级关系,增强可读性和组织性。此外,权限名称应具备一定的扩展性和稳定性,既要能适应未来业务新增的需求,又要在业务逻辑不变时避免频繁更改,以维持现有权限分配的有效性。
常见误区与演进趋势在实践中,设置权限名称常会陷入一些误区。一是过度具体化,为每一个细微差异的操作都设置独立名称,导致权限列表膨胀,难以管理;二是过度抽象化,使用“高级管理”、“一般操作”等模糊名称,使得权限分配失去精确控制的意义;三是与技术实现强耦合,名称中直接包含数据库表名或代码函数名,一旦底层技术重构,名称便失去意义。随着技术发展,权限名称的设置也呈现新的趋势。一方面,与属性基访问控制模型结合,权限名称可能演变为动态策略的描述标签,而非静态操作列表。另一方面,在零信任架构下,权限名称需要与持续的风险评估和上下文信息更灵活地关联。同时,自然语言处理技术的应用,使得系统能够更智能地理解权限名称的语义,甚至支持用户用更自然的语言描述权限需求,再由系统匹配或生成对应的权限名称。这些演进都预示着,权限名称作为人机交互的关键接口,其设计与应用将朝着更加智能化、语义化和业务融合化的方向发展。
74人看过